The Structure of Swedish Driving Licenses

Sweden categorizes driving licenses into distinct classes, each authorizing the holder to operate various kinds of automobiles. Comprehending these classifications helps applicants pursue the appropriate license for their desired needs without unnecessary hold-ups or expenses.

The most commonly looked for license is Class B, which permits the operation of automobile and light trucks weighing approximately 3,500 kilograms. This license covers most of personal transport requirements and works as the foundation upon which extra recommendations can later develop. For motorcycle enthusiasts, Class A supplies complete motorbike privileges, while Class A1 offers a restricted option for smaller sized displacement bikes. Those thinking about business driving will experience Class C for trucks and Class D for buses, each carrying more stringent requirements showing the increased obligation these automobiles need.

The Step-by-Step Application Process

Starting the journey toward a Swedish driving license involves navigating a structured process that progressively develops skills and demonstrates readiness for the obligation of independent driving. This procedure normally spans a number of months, allowing sufficient time for skill advancement and understanding acquisition.

The journey starts with getting a learner's permit, known in Swedish as" körkortstillstånd." This authorization licenses the holder to practice driving under specified conditions, usually requiring the presence of a certified manager aged 25 or older who has held a license for a minimum of 5 years. The student's authorization application needs passing a vision test and sending a medical statement, in addition to the suitable charge to Transportstyrelsen.

Following authorization approval, applicants register with a certified driving school to start their mandatory training. The curriculum unfolds throughout multiple phases, starting with basic lorry operation and progressing through significantly intricate traffic scenarios. Students should complete specific numbers of lessons in numerous categories, consisting of driving on various roadway types, in differing climate condition, and during night driving. The theory element prepares prospects for the written assessment, covering traffic rules, roadway indications, danger understanding, and ecological considerations.

The conclusion of the training process arrives with the useful driving test, officially described the" körprov." This assessment assesses the prospect's ability to run the lorry securely, make appropriate choices in traffic, and demonstrate the protective driving skills cultivated throughout their training. The test generally lasts in between 30 and 45 minutes and includes both controlled maneuvers and open-road driving in genuine traffic conditions.

Investment Considerations: Time and Cost

Preparing for a Swedish driving license needs both considerable time dedication and monetary investment. While precise expenses vary based on specific aptitude, geographic place, and picked driving school, prospective license holders need to prepare for expenditures ranging from 15,000 to 25,000 Swedish kronor for a standard Class B license.

The time needed to complete the procedure likewise varies based upon several factors. Most prospects require between 6 months and one year from preliminary application to successful test completion, though this timeline can extend considerably for those with minimal practice opportunities or those who do not pass assessments on their first efforts. The compulsory" risk education" courses, which resolve harmful scenarios without useful driving part, include additional time requirements that can not be sped up.
